美国云服务器:高可用集群管理与智能负载均衡实战
在构建面向海外用户的高可用应用时,合理的集群管理与智能负载均衡策略是保障服务稳定性的核心。本文面向站长、企业与开发者,结合在美国云服务器部署的实践,详细解析高可用集群的设计原理、常见应用场景、与其他地域(如香港服务器、日本服务器、韩国服务器、新加坡服务器等)的优势对比,并给出选购与实施建议。文末提供可直接访问的产品链接,便于快速试用与上手。
高可用集群的基本原理
高可用(High Availability, HA)集群的目标是将单点故障影响降到最低,确保应用在硬件/网络/软件故障下仍能对外提供服务。实现要点包括:
- 冗余部署:多台实例分布在不同可用区(Availability Zone)或不同数据中心,避免单机或单机房故障导致整体不可用。
- 健康检查与自动故障恢复:通过心跳检测、健康探针(HTTP/TCP/ICMP)判断实例健康状态,发现异常自动剔除并触发自动扩缩容或重建流程。
- 状态管理与会话一致性:采用无状态设计(stateless)优先,必要时通过分布式缓存(Redis/Memcached)或会话粘滞策略确保会话不丢失。
- 数据层高可用:使用主从/主主复制、分布式存储(如Ceph、GlusterFS)、数据库集群(MySQL主备、Galera、PostgreSQL streaming replication)来保证数据持久性与一致性。
实例分布与可用区策略
在美国云服务器环境中,应优先选择多可用区部署:将前端负载均衡器、应用实例和数据库节点分布到至少两个可用区,配置跨区同步与心跳。跨可用区网络延迟与带宽是设计考虑点,通常需要对内部通信使用私有网络或VPC对等连接,并启用压缩与连接池优化。
智能负载均衡机制与实现细节
智能负载均衡(Intelligent Load Balancing)不仅是简单的流量分发,还要结合健康状态、资源利用率与业务优先级对请求进行调度,具体实现包括:
- 基于权重与实时性能的调度:通过采集各实例的CPU、内存、响应时间等指标,动态调整权重,从而将更多请求分发给性能更优的实例。
- 会话保持(Session Affinity)与无状态优先策略:对于需要粘滞会话的应用,可启用基于Cookie或源IP的会话保持;对于大规模网站与API服务,应尽量改造为无状态,便于水平扩展。
- 按地理位置与延迟路由:结合GeoDNS或全局负载均衡(GSLB),将用户请求就近引导到香港服务器、美国服务器或其他最近节点,降低访问延迟。
- 熔断与限流策略:在负载均衡层实现熔断(circuit breaker)和令牌桶限流,防止单个服务过载影响整体可用性。
- SSL/TLS 卸载与HTTP/2支持:在L7负载均衡器上完成TLS终止,减轻后端实例证书处理负担,同时启用HTTP/2或gRPC以提升连接复用与性能。
常见部署架构范例
典型的高可用架构包括如下组件协同工作:
- 公网入口:全球负载均衡或云提供的L4/L7服务。
- 边缘CDN:缓存静态资源并在全球节点分发,配合香港VPS或新加坡服务器作为区域加速节点。
- 应用层:部署在美国云服务器的多实例Auto Scaling组,结合运行时健康检查自动扩缩容。
- 状态缓存:Redis集群(主从或哨兵模式)分布式部署,保证会话与热点数据低延迟访问。
- 数据持久化:关系型数据库主从复制或分布式数据库,备份与异地容灾(例如将数据异步复制到香港或日本节点)。
应用场景与典型问题处理
不同业务场景对高可用与负载均衡的侧重点不同:
- 电商与交易类:强调强一致性与低延迟,常采用主从同步+读写分离、严格的事务控制与跨可用区容灾。
- 内容分发与媒体流:侧重带宽与缓存策略,结合CDN、边缘节点与负载均衡的分级缓存策略。
- API与微服务架构:偏向无状态设计、服务网格(如Istio/Linkerd)用于流量管理、熔断、监控与追踪。
在实践中常见问题与解决策略包括:
- 突发流量导致扩容滞后:采用预留容量、预热策略、以及快速扩容触发阈值。
- 跨区域数据一致性不足:可通过异步复制+幂等设计,或采用分布式事务/补偿机制。
- 长连接资源耗尽(如WebSocket/gRPC):使用连接池、限流以及独立的连接网关来分离长连接负载。
优势对比:美国云与其他区域选择
在选择部署地区时,应综合考虑访问地域、合规要求、价格与网络质量:
- 美国服务器:适合面向北美用户及全球业务的主干节点,带宽与弹性资源充足,生态成熟,适合部署数据分析、广告及SaaS后端。
- 香港服务器 / 香港VPS:面向中国大陆及东南亚访问具有天然优势,网络延迟低,适合作为边缘节点或中转。
- 日本服务器、韩国服务器、新加坡服务器:分别在东北亚和东南亚市场表现优异,适合区域加速与本地化服务。
- 美国VPS:成本与灵活性兼顾,适合小型站点或开发测试环境连接到全球网络。
此外,域名注册与DNS策略也会影响全球访问体验。结合全球Anycast DNS与地理定位解析可以进一步优化用户的首跳时延。
选购建议与实施要点
在为业务选购美国云服务器或混合多地域方案时,建议遵循以下步骤:
- 明确业务目标与SLA:根据目标RTO/RPO确定可用区数量、备份频率与故障演练计划。
- 网络与带宽规划:预估峰值带宽需求,考虑公网出口、DDoS防护与内网带宽,以及跨区链路延迟。
- 容器化与自动化:优先采用容器与Kubernetes等编排平台,配合CI/CD实现快速发布与回滚。
- 监控与告警:部署全栈监控(Prometheus、Grafana、ELK/EFK),设置细粒度告警与自动化响应流程。
- 安全与合规:开启入侵检测、防火墙规则、密钥管理与数据加密,满足目标市场的合规要求。
- 成本与性能平衡:利用按需/预留/可抢占实例组合,结合负载预测优化资源成本。
部署示例:在美国云上实现HA+智能LB的简要流程
- 搭建VPC网络,配置多可用区子网与路由表。
- 部署L7负载均衡器,开启健康检查、SSL卸载与会话策略。
- 在Auto Scaling组中部署应用容器或虚拟机,并配置启动脚本与镜像仓库(私有Registry)。
- 部署Redis/数据库集群并启用备份与异地复制策略。
- 配合CDN与GeoDNS实现全球流量调度,针对中国大陆用户可优先路由至香港服务器或香港VPS。
- 上线后进行故障演练(例如模拟单区不可用),验证自动故障转移与恢复时长。
总结
构建面向全球用户的高可用系统,需要在架构设计、智能负载均衡、数据一致性与运维自动化之间取得平衡。美国云服务器在全球覆盖、弹性资源和生态支持方面具有明显优势,适合作为主干节点与计算密集型服务部署。同时,结合香港服务器、日本服务器、韩国服务器、新加坡服务器等边缘或区域节点,能够为不同地域用户提供更佳的访问体验。选择合适的VPS或云实例类型、合理配置网络与监控策略、并在上线前进行充分的故障演练,是保障业务稳定性的关键。
如需了解后浪云在美国节点的具体产品与配置选项,可访问我们的美国云服务器页面:https://www.idc.net/cloud-us;更多关于后浪云及域名注册、海外服务器等信息,请参阅官网:https://www.idc.net/

